Redruth RFC has gone from strength to strength year on year, with sucess on the pitch fuelled by the efforts of a veritable army of volunteers who lend their time, ideas, skills and expertise to the club that they love. Ex-players, mini-junior parents, friends and fans fill a diverse selection of roles from scorekeepers to stewards, from fundraisers to physios and from ball boys to bar staff.
